SuperAguri wrote:Regarding team names, although the official F1 website lists the team as Aston Martin, it was a time when contructors sold chassis to teams, so Cooper did not enter 12 Cooper Climax cars into the British Grand Prix rather Cooper had 3 cars, but a number of other teams used them like Rob Walker Racing, Equipe Nationale Belge, Reg Parnell and the wonderfully named Ace Garage. Technically Aston Martin were entered as a team as the David Brown Corporation rather then Aston Martin although the Chassis was entered as an Aston Martin. So technically isn't it the David Brown Corporation team profile?...
Hmm, forgotten that Carroll Shelby, he of sports car and Shelby sports cars fame is in fact an F1 Reject as he entered 8 races and although is listed as coming 4th in the 1958 Italian GP, he was sharing a drive and could not score points and he had already retired on Lap 1 of the race too....
